  • Title

    A novel method for automatic 2D-to-3D video conversion

  • Abstract
    In this paper, we propose an efficient scheme to automatically convert existing 2D videos to 3D ones. The proposed method extracts motion information from two consecutive frames to estimate depth map for each of them. In the method, we first develop a region-based Graph cut method to fast and accurately perform motion segmentation, which is robust to large interframe motions. Then, a depth assigning step for the segments is conducted to obtain a smooth depth map for each frame. Experimental results on standard testing sequences demonstrate that our scheme achieves accurate motion segmentation and accordingly smooth depth map.
